DESCRIPTION: | No. 19285 |
Mineral: | Elbaite Tourmaline var. Watermelon Tourmaline |
Locality: | Kunar, Afghanistan |
Description: | Gem nodule of translucent elbaite tourmaline with outer green layer surrounding a pink center giving the watermelon name. The crystal pocket ruptured during formation, breaking the crystal, then the surfaces continued to grow smoothing the nodule. |
Overall Size: | 21x21x20 mm |
Crystals: | 21 mm |
